Published by Taylor & Francis Ltd in 2018, this hardback edition spans 248 pages and offers a comprehensive exploration of cultural sustainability. The book delves into the nature-culture interface, conceptualized as a dynamic meeting place where diverse experiences, practices, policies, ideas, and knowledge converge.
